How much does it cost to rent a home in Grant County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Grant County 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$946 | $799 | $1,200 |
| Grant County 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,281 | $999 | $1,650 |
| Grant County 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,507 | $1,440 | $1,575 |

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Grant County?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Grant County ranges from $530 to $1,650 with an average monthly rent of $1,056.
